Transaction 93593fbabe2c0004f333b79c9a7f119a8575e03644cd9fcdd870893d686f6674
1 Input
1 Output
-
93593fbabe2c0004f333b79c9a7f119a8575e03644cd9fcdd870893d686f6674:0
- value
- 443898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8524b57cbe3bbf8c383a161cf2a9a8df994f01fa OP_EQUAL
- address
- 3Dq1mdzpsSqAprSw5QT3FfjULWBTa53mVP